Research Summary:

I create public art projects that are site, and what I refer to as “user –specific.” These artworks speak directly to a specific visual and conceptual vocabulary relating to the users of the facility. The projects involve the integration analogue and digital technology with hand crafted and commercially fabricated production processes. In my personal museum and gallery work, I have been involved with the intersection of technology and vision with artistic production. I have created the term “photocentric” to describe my carefully crafted airbrushed paintings. I am interested in the way we "see" and the manner in which contemporary culture consumes images.
